What is BPMN?

BPMN is a graphical representation standard used to model business processes. It provides a set of symbols and conventions that make it easy to depict workflows, decision points, and process flows. Originally designed for business processes, BPMN has become increasingly popular in engineering contexts for its clarity and precision.

Creating BPMN Diagrams for Engineering Processes

Designing effective BPMN diagrams involves understanding the core symbols and their meanings. Key elements include:

  • Events: Circles representing start, intermediate, or end points.
  • Activities: Rectangles showing tasks or actions.
  • Gateways: Diamonds indicating decision points or process splits.
  • Flows: Arrows connecting elements to show process direction.

When modeling engineering processes, it’s important to clearly define each step, decision, and flow to ensure the diagram accurately reflects the real-world process.
